Effects of genotype, inoculation and maturity stage at harvest on red clover (Trifolium pratense L.) yield and chemical composition
Red clover is a highly productive, protein-rich fodder crop, with more “bypass” proteins and more digestible fibres than alfalfa providing more energy dense forage to lactating dairy cows diets.
